alex0707
Forum Replies Created
-
Спасибо за ответ.
проблема решилась путем добавления стороннего плагина. Он делает следующее – скрывает поля и убтрает принудительное заполнение поля.
заработало с плагином Checkout Field Editor for WooCommerce. С другими либо частично (не все поля скрывало) либо триал версия..
А сам плагин НП работает отлично. Спасибо.P.S.
Еще уточнение. А как выставить мин сумму заказа для НП?
Т.е. Клиент заказывает что-то на сумму 300. А заказчик хочет что бы все что ниже 500, не оформлялось.. Сам метод что бы отображался. но при подтверждении заказа, что бы появлялся нотис с инфой, что минимальная стоимость заказа 500.
На данный момент на странице корзины методы доставки спрятаны. Есть только на странице “checkout”.
нашел некий код. Но не пойму как сделать зацеп на способ доставки новая почта…add_action( ‘woocommerce_checkout_process’, ‘truemisha_no_checkout_min_order_amount’ );
function truemisha_no_checkout_min_order_amount() {$minimum_amount =500;
$chosen_methods = WC()->session->get( ‘chosen_shipping_methods’ );
if ( WC()->$chosen_methods === ‘shipping_method_0_nova_poshta_shipping-3’ || WC()->cart->subtotal < $minimum_amount ) {
wc_add_notice(
sprintf(
‘Минимальная сумма заказа %s, а у вы хотите заказать всего лишь на %s.’ ,
wc_price( $minimum_amount ),
wc_price( WC()->cart->subtotal )
),
‘error’
);
}
}Реакции нет, так что нужно самостоятельно допиливать.
Немного танцев с бубном и будет работать.